Position

Summary

As an FP&A Senior Manager on the Pharmacy Services Trade Finance team, you will provide strategic leadership and oversight for financial planning and analysis functions by coordinating budgeting and forecasting processes, providing insights and recommendations on financial strategy, and collaborating with stakeholders to align financial goals with business objectives. You will ensure accurate financial reporting through the integration of advanced modeling techniques, robust business analytics, and process improvement initiatives.

This is a high visibility opportunity and provides a unique platform to leverage modern expertise, think creatively, and deliver transformative results.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ain financial models to support rebate program evaluations and scenario/sensitivity analyses.
  • Manage the development of rebate financial planning and analysis processes, ensuring alignment with business partners and overarching business objectives.
  • Lead the team’s preparation of accurate and timely financial forecasts, budgets, accrual, and variance analysis related to the Zinc contracting entity.
  • Assist with the analysis of rebate program performance through identifying trends, risks, and prepare recommendations to optimize profitability.
